HeySummit empowers anyone to run amazing virtual summits from anywhere. From selling tickets and organising speakers, to managing talks and outreach, HeySummit is a complete wrap-around system for organisers of online conferences, speaker series, media libraries and summits.
Everyday, people use HeySummit in new ways to spread human knowledge and with a smaller carbon footprint.
We are a small team with backgrounds in building businesses that delight customers. With HeySummit, we’re on a mission to be the best way to spread human knowledge.
HeySummit is a business borne out of need, after Ben wanted to run an online conference and couldn’t find something to do the trick. He didn’t have a solution, so decided to build one. After a successful summit and listening to the 50th person begging to know what platform he’d used, the decision to open HeySummit to the world was made.
